python 1090 sensor bypass question
on my system im going to have the glass brake sensor, tilt sensor and a AU94T. im also installing window modules and trunk popper.
so my question is does the python 1090 automatically bypass the sensors when using the trunk popper or the window modules through aux channels?

Most DEI alarms disarm when "trunk pop" is used, but not if other EXT outputs are used and sensors are not bypassed, they should not need to be bypassed if using window control, a proximity sensor "sees" through glass and impact sensitivity is set too high, [or improperly installed] if triggered by window movement. 94
ok, cool. the directions say if you have a proximity sensor to wire it to a relay so when you roll down the windows it bypasses the sensor. so i should be fine without bypassing the sensor at all?
I have never installed a relay for that, and I have done more then a few alarms with proximity sensors and window modules, I have an Alpine alarm with a dual stage "radar" sensor in my 94LS and I can roll the windows down without any problems, [module is a DEI 530T].
Install it without the relay, if there is a problem, add the relay. 94
